I was in Ubud in Bali, where I spent 2 days. Ubud is a nice town, centre of art etc. I bought loads of souvenirs. Visited Kechak dance performance. Those of you who saw movie Baraka will know what it is.
I visited also Monkey forest. Later I should add some pics of how a monkey grabbed my T-shirt, I await photos from my new Taiwanese friends whom I met some 3 times during my travels.
The monkeys are very spoiled, coz their are holy in Hindu religion. They will grab whatever food you have. Or try search through your bags. And are becoming aggressive very easily.
Before going to the Bali airport I visited Kuta, where are fine beaches, renowned for surfing. I wanted to take a last dip in water, last swim. But otherwise the city is unattractive, full of shops, pubs and people .... I heard for at least hundred times: "Yes, sir, taxi ? Transport ?" And also almost all the taxis passing by in quite narrow streets using their horn just to attract my attention. It was pretty stressful, as at the beginning I
always thought the car is going to hit me or what. No, just wanted to get a customer.
In Kuta there were the bombings 6 years ago.
I took a night flight with Lionair, it was pretty nice, at first I dreaded it a bit, coz I read some bad stories, about delays, cancellation, but the flight was nice, and I even got a dinner, cakes, juice ... despite that it is supposed to be a lowcost airline. For Bali - Singapore I paid 71 USD (2 and half hour flight).
